find the center of a circle with the equation: x^2 + y^2 - 2y - 8x - 19 = 0

Answer:

(4, 1)

Step-by-step explanation:

x^2 + y^2 - 2y - 8x - 19 = 0

We rearrange the terms and complete the square twice.

x^2 - 8x + y^2 - 2y = 19

x^2 - 8x + 16 + y^2 - 2y + 1 = 19 + 16 + 1

(x - 4)^2 + (y - 1)^2 = 6^2

The center is (4, 1)
